There’s a new Australian cyber security law almost no one is talking about and it quietly took effect on 4 March 2026. The Cyber Security (Security Standards for Smart Devices) Rules 2025 set the first mandatory security baseline for smart devices sold in Australia. Most business owners have never heard of it. Here’s what it actually requires, who it binds, and — more importantly — what it means for the smart devices already sitting on your business network.
The Smart Device Security Rules 2025 (in force from 4 March 2026) place mandatory security obligations on the manufacturers, importers and suppliers of consumer smart devices not on ordinary businesses that simply use them. So if you just own smart cameras, routers or speakers, you’re not directly breaking the law. But the rules exist because so many IoT devices are insecure by default — and those devices are very likely already on your network, creating a real risk you should audit.
What are the Smart Device Security Rules 2025?
They’re Australia’s first mandatory cyber security standard for consumer smart devices, made under the Cyber Security Act 2024 and part of the 2023–2030 Australian Cyber Security Strategy. After a 12-month transition, they commenced on 4 March 2026.
The rules set three baseline requirements for in-scope devices (aligned with the international ETSI EN 303 645 standard and the UK’s PSTI Act):
- No universal default passwords — devices can’t ship with generic logins like “admin” or “1234”. Passwords must be unique per device or set by the user at setup.
- A vulnerability reporting channel — manufacturers must publish a clear, free way for people to report security flaws.
- A defined security update period — manufacturers must state, up front, how long a device will receive security updates, including an end date they can’t shorten.
Who do the rules actually apply to?
This is the part most alarmist headlines get wrong. The legal obligations fall on manufacturers, importers and suppliers of smart devices — the people who make, bring in, or sell them into the Australian consumer market.
- Manufacturers must build in-scope devices to meet the standards.
- Suppliers must not sell non-compliant in-scope devices, and must include a statement of compliance (kept on record for five years).
So the literal question “is my business non-compliant?” only applies directly to device makers and sellers. For everyone else, the real message is different — and arguably more important.
If you make, brand or sell smart devices, you’re in scope
Worth pausing here, because the definition of “manufacturer” is broad. You may be caught even if you don’t build the hardware yourself. The rules can apply if your business:
- Assembles or produces smart devices
- Puts your brand or name on a device (white-labelling)
- Imports devices where the overseas maker has no Australian presence
- Sells in-scope devices as a supplier
If any of that is you, this is a compliance project: check product design against the three standards, get statements of compliance, and keep records for five years. This is where a cyber security and GRC partner earns its keep.
The bigger issue for most businesses: the devices already on your network
Here’s why this law matters even if you never sell a single device. It exists because most smart devices have historically been insecure by default — shipped with weak passwords, no update path, and no way to report flaws. And those exact devices are almost certainly already on your business network right now:
- Security cameras and NVRs
- Wi-Fi routers and access points
- Smart TVs in meeting rooms
- Smart speakers and assistants
- Door locks, sensors, building automation
- Networked printers
Every one of these is a potential entry point. A single smart camera with a default password can be the crack an attacker uses to reach your whole network.
What smart devices are covered (and what’s exempt)?
In scope: most consumer-grade connectable products — smart TVs, cameras, routers, smart speakers, wearables, smart locks, and home-automation gear that connects to the internet or a network, manufactured on or after 4 March 2026.
Exempt (listed in the rules): desktop computers, laptops, tablets, smartphones, certain therapeutic goods, and road vehicles/components. These are handled by other frameworks.
Note the timing catch: the standards apply to devices manufactured on or after 4 March 2026. Older stock made before that date isn’t required to comply — which means plenty of not-secure-by-default devices are still perfectly legal to buy for a while yet. Buyer beware.
What should your business actually do?
Even though the law targets manufacturers, smart businesses are treating March 2026 as the prompt to get their own house in order. Here’s the practical checklist:
- Inventory your smart devices — you can’t secure what you don’t know you have.
- Change every default password — the single biggest, cheapest win.
- Check update status — is each device still receiving security updates? Retire ones that aren’t.
- Segment your network — put IoT devices on a separate network from your core systems and data.
- Prefer compliant devices — when buying, look for the new standards (unique passwords, published support period, vulnerability contact).
- Secure your cameras especially — CCTV/NVRs are a classic weak point; align with proper network security.
- Fold it into your IT baseline — make device security part of ongoing managed IT, not a one-off.
How this fits the bigger 2026 compliance picture
The Smart Device Rules don’t stand alone. They’re part of a wave of Australian cyber regulation now landing on businesses: the Cyber Security Act 2024, mandatory ransomware reporting, stronger Privacy Act enforcement, and the Essential Eight baseline for anyone doing government or enterprise work.
The common thread: cyber security is shifting from “good practice” to “baseline expectation” — from insurers, regulators, and the clients who audit their suppliers. Insecure IoT is increasingly treated as a faulty, unsafe product. Businesses that get ahead of this now look more credible and more insurable than those that wait.

Frequently Asked Questions
When did Australia’s smart device security rules start?
The Cyber Security (Security Standards for Smart Devices) Rules 2025 commenced on 4 March 2026, after a 12-month transition period. They apply to in-scope consumer smart devices manufactured on or after that date and form part of the Cyber Security Act 2024 and the 2023–2030 Australian Cyber Security Strategy.
Does my business have to comply with the smart device rules?
Only if your business manufactures, imports, brands or supplies consumer smart devices. The legal obligations fall on those parties, not on businesses that simply use smart devices. If you use IoT devices, you have no direct legal duty — but securing them is strongly advisable, since they’re a common attack entry point.
What do the new smart device standards require?
Three baseline obligations: no universal default passwords (unique or user-set), a published channel to report security vulnerabilities, and a clearly stated minimum period for security updates including an end date. These align with the international ETSI EN 303 645 standard and the UK’s PSTI Act.
Which devices are covered by the rules?
Most consumer connectable products — smart TVs, cameras, routers, smart speakers, wearables, smart locks and home automation — manufactured on or after 4 March 2026. Desktops, laptops, tablets, smartphones, certain therapeutic goods and road vehicles are exempt, as they’re covered by other frameworks.
Are my existing smart devices now illegal?
No. Devices manufactured before 4 March 2026 aren’t required to meet the new standards, and using them isn’t illegal. However, many older devices are insecure by default, so it’s wise to audit them, change default passwords, and retire any that no longer receive security updates.
Why are smart devices a cyber security risk?
Many IoT devices ship with default passwords, lack a way to report flaws, and stop getting security updates — making them easy entry points to a network. A single compromised camera or router can give an attacker a foothold, which is exactly why Australia introduced mandatory secure-by-default standards.
